Birmingham-Southern College (EIN: 63-0288811)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2017. In its fiscal year 2019 IRS Form 990 filing, Birmingham-Southern College,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 14 out of 865 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$151,155. The highest compensated employee at Birmingham-Southern College is Bradley J Caskey with fiscal year 2019 compensation of $220,739.

Mission Statement

BIRMINGHAM-SOUTHERN COLLEGE PREPARES MEN AND WOMEN FOR LIVES OF SIGNIFICANCE. THE COLLEGE FOSTERS INTELLECTUAL AND PERSONAL DEVELOPMENT THROUGH EXCELLENCE IN TEACHING AND SCHOLARSHIP AND BY CHALLENGING STUDENTS TO ENGAGE THEIR COMMUNITY AND THE GREATER WORLD, TO EXAMINE DIVERSE PERSPECTIVES, AND TO LIVE WITH INTEGRITY. A RESIDENTIAL, BACCALAUREATE LIBERAL ARTS INSTITUTION, BIRMINGHAM-SOUTHERN HONORS ITS METHODIST HERITAGE OF INFORMED INQUIRY AND MEANINGFUL SERVICE.
